The Process
Thanksgiving Break 2005 was a time where most of [what would become] the development team appreciated the much needed time off. When we returned from break Alex gave us quite the surprise. He played a Halo PC map...of our own campus. The idea was revolutionary, and suddenly we were rushing to learn the development tools of Bungie's Halo Editing Kit. Matt began taking pictures of every possible texture on campus, and then suddenly we had one gigabyte of random campus pictures. Brad initially spent a whole weekend learning to use 3DS Max--he had a hard time pulling himself away from the computer. We all began to understand why Alex spent all of break on the map, and after several months of dedication we have a recognizable map of WPI's campus. Actually, that statement is quite modest. Harrington Auditorium and Daniels and Morgan Hall look exquisite. Thanks to Josh and Matt, our new website also looks amazing. Currently, we are trying to improve gameplay in the map. The recent Halo Tournament (March 31, 2006) gave us many new ideas. We eventually hope to develop the WPI Campus Map for other games such as Quake, Unreal, and Counter-Strike. This project will continue into our alumni years, as we hope to include every minor detail of the campus. Hopefully, this new trend of creating campus maps will evolve into an interactive game design business.

The Map
Below is an official list of map releases, their release dates, and the changes made to the map for each release.
05/09/2006--Version 1.0--First public release.
-Riley texturing complete
-Daniels texturing complete
-Bartlett Center texturing complete
-Fuller staircase complete
-Fuller flagbase teleporter configuration changed
-New teleporters added in the quad and Campus Center areas
-Glass bridge from Fuller to Atwater Kent added
-Glass walls added for playability reasons
-Alden, harrington, and fuller ladders fixed/added
04/12/2006--Beta 2--Private beta.
-Quad texturing complete
-Harrington, Daniels, Morgan, Fuller, Fitness Center, Alden Memorial, and Campus Center detailing
-Morgan texturing complete
-Harrington texturing complete
-Added red WPI vehicles
-Added the Bartlett Center
-Added underground tunnel system
03/15/2006--Beta 1--Private beta.
-Building footprints extruded
-Fountain structure modeled
-Minor detailing on select buildings (Morgan, Campus Center)
